The place of Francisco May is inside the municipality of Isla Mujeres (in the State of Quintana Roo). There are 284 inhabitants. Of all the towns in the municipality, it occupies the number #3 in terms of number of inhabitants. Francisco May is at 8 meters of altitude.

Data: In Francisco May, there is a percentage of 80% of indigenous population and 61% of the households have a cell phone. Need more statistics on Francisco May? They are at the bottom of this page.

The town of Francisco May is located at 37.3 kilometers from Isla Mujeres, which is the most populated locality in the municipality, in the West direction. If you browse our webpage, you will also find a map with the location of Francisco May.
